How do the cushions on this sofa resist fading from the sun?
The cushions are upholstered in high-performance, solution-dyed acrylic fabric. In solution-dyed materials, the color is integrated into the fibers during the manufacturing process rather than just applied to the surface. This creates a fabric that is highly resistant to UV-induced fading and moisture damage, ensuring the bisque-colored cushions retain their clean, neutral look even when placed in direct sunlight.
What maintenance is required for the teak accents on the arms?
The arms of this sofa are detailed with genuine teak accents, a premium wood known for its natural oils and exceptional resistance to rot and insects. While teak is incredibly durable, it will naturally transition to a sophisticated silver-gray patina over time. Based on our expertise with this material, we recommend a regular wipe-down with mild soap and water. If you prefer to maintain the original warm wood tone, a teak-specific sealer can be applied periodically.

We purchased the Solana Sofa and the Loveseat for a covered, screened porch in Georgia. Within 11 days of delivery, the teak armrests developed significant mold growth—even though we were out of town for a week and the furniture had not been used. The furniture is marketed as suitable for humid climates, so this was extremely disappointing. We followed RTG's recommended 50/50 bleach cleaning method, but staining remained in the wood, and the mold keeps coming back with humidity. Customer service advised that this was normal "maintenance" that they were not liable for. Their only recommendation was to purchase teak maintenance products. I wish I had been told to do that in the first place. For the price of this furniture, I did not expect to be dealing with mold remediation less than two weeks after delivery. Buyers in humid climates should be aware that the wood components require immediate and ongoing maintenance.
